The frame start sequence (FSS) is illustrated in Figure 20.3, and contains the following
fields:
Preamble (PRE) - apredefined pattern of 10101010. This is used to synchronise the
receiving clocks.
Frame start delimiter (FSD) - a predefined pattern of 1V + V - 10V - V + 0, which defines the
start of the CAD field. Note that violations (V + and V - ) cannot occur within this field.
Control and data (CAD) - contains information on the data link layer.
Frame end delimiter (FED) - a predefined pattern of 1V + V - V + V - 101, which defines the
end of the CAD field.
